Analysis of the efficiency of SHA algorithms based on message length

Аннотатсия

This study analyzes the efficiency of SHA (Secure Hash Algorithm) family algorithms depending on message length. The execution time of hashing processes for SHA-1 and SHA-2 (SHA-224, SHA-256, SHA-384, SHA-512) algorithms is compared across various message lengths. Python programming language is used for implementation, and the results are presented in graphical and tabular forms. The study examines the computational complexity and performance speed of these algorithms. The main objective is to determine the efficiency of each algorithm relative to message length and recommend an optimal option for practical applications. Special attention is given to balancing execution speed and computational complexity. The results highlight similarities and differences among the algorithms, providing valuable insights for selecting the most efficient algorithm in real-time systems or large-scale data processing.
